22.01.2022 Quick little job - chest strap moving. The rug was too big in the chest. Instead of putting in darts, we were able to move the chest strap up the rug to tighten it up. This is a great option for creating more room in the shoulders to prevent rubbing.

08.01.2022 This is how we patch your rugs... We start by assessing the damage. Then we tidy up the area by removing any destroyed or unnecessary pieces. After that, well do our best to match the fabric - in this case its a canvas patch for a canvas rug. Cut the patch to size and get to work by covering the area and reinforcing the parts that need reinforcement which in this case was the top of the patch where the rug takes more pressure and around the leg strap hook-on loop. This rug had ripped away from the binding (completely torn, not unstitched) so we added a new line of binding to enable us to reattach the tail flap without changing the shape of the rug.

06.01.2022 What is one thing you’d like to see improved on your horses rugs? For me it’s the neck rug. Every combo whether it be hooded or hoodless, rubs my horses manes out on the second half of the neck. Is it because they bunch up there? Does the seam go stiff and create a problem. Do they heat up and cause friction? Are they too heavy? I have a few ideas on what could be improved... so I have created the first prototype of what will hopefully be a non rubbing neck rug. It has no cen...tre seam down the mane yet is still lightly lined, and it is super lightweight at just 300 grams! It is a 98% cotton outer so is lovely and cool yet still has a ripstop weave making it paddock sturdy. It has a Velcro strap at the poll designed to be done up relatively firmly behind the ears to avoid slippage down the neck and lightweight but strong clips strategically placed to maximise airflow. Watch this space in the coming weeks to see how it performs and what adjustments I’ll be making. This will be added to a (now) neckless rug using a heavy duty Lycra gusset. See more

01.01.2022 It doesnt look like much but this rug needed a new panel made for the back as it had been completely ripped off both sides. We made it nice and strong to support the leg straps, fixed the spine and added a recycled tail flap to complete the job.
